What affects the price

When you look at garage door repairs, the total cost depends on a few moving parts. The main factors are the type of door you have, the specific hardware that failed, and the complexity of the labor involved. For example, replacing a single heavy-duty spring is a different job than repairing a damaged track or an opener motor that has burned out. What are common garage door sensor issues in New York?

Common garage door sensor issues in New York, New York, include misalignment, dirt or debris obstructing the beam, or faulty wiring. These sensors are crucial for safety, preventing the door from closing on obstacles. If they malfunction, the door may refuse to close or reverse unexpectedly. What are the risks of not repairing a garage door torsion spring in New York?

Not repairing a broken garage door torsion spring in New York, New York, is extremely dangerous. The springs counterbalance the door’s weight; without them, the door becomes incredibly heavy and can fall rapidly, causing severe injury or property damage. What are some common issues with garage door rollers in New York?

In New York, New York, common garage door roller issues include wear and tear from frequent use, leading to noisy operation, difficulty opening the door, or rollers detaching from the track.
